  1/5: Gazans flee homes and seek refuge in UN schools (al Jazeera)
  As the humanitarian crisis in Gaza worsens, many families are being displaced. About 13,000 people have fled their homes because of Israel's continuing assault on Gaza. Many lived on the outskirts of the Strip and are now in Gaza City, staying at UN schools that have been turned into makeshift shelters. Sherine Tadros spoke to some Gazans who say there is nowhere they feel safe. (al Jazeera)

  1/4: Gaza hospital struggles to cope with casualties (al Jazeera)
  According to the United Nations, at least 507 Palestinians have been killed, and more than 2,400 injured since Israel began its offensive in Gaza. A quarter of those killed are civilians. Hospitals are at breaking point, families devastated, people are being forced from their homes. Al Jazeera is the only international broadcaster with a presence in Gaza. Sherine Tadros reports from the epicentre of Gaza's struggle to survive - its main hospital. (al Jazeera)

  1/1 CAIR: Muslim Passengers Removed From DC Flight
  The Council on American-Islamic Relations (CAIR) said that nine American Muslims, most of them headed to Florida for a vacation with family members, were removed from an AirTran Airways flight Thursday afternoon at Reagan National Airport.
